Western CUNA Management School Changes Its Name

CLAREMONT, Calif.— Western CUNA Management School has changed its name to Western Credit Union Management School, the organization reported.

The name was changed to reflect the institution’s ongoing commitment to innovation and dedication in meeting the evolving needs of the credit union movement, WCMS said.

The new name “marks a milestone in the school’s 64-year history, signifying the school's commitment to continuous improvement and its recognition of the dynamic, transformative landscape of the credit union leadership landscape,” the organization said.

“Western Credit Union Management School is built on a tradition of head and heart excellence — our institution remains a beacon that continues illuminating the future of our industry,” said Dr. Michael Steinberger, dean and chief academic officer for WCMS. “This change signifies the school's unwavering commitment to equipping leaders with the tools and foresight needed to navigate the challenges and opportunities that lie ahead. Western Credit Union Management School will continue to be the hallmark for leadership development in credit unions.”
